Что такое Гипервизор ?

int_pc_computersЗадумался тут недавно что же такое гипервизор ? 🙁
Неожиданно как то в башку залезло — а что же такое гипервизор и почему я не знаю что такое гипервизор , где его применяют и зачем ? Загадка то какая …. Спросил google, он в меня бросил ссылкой на википедию откуда и взят материал:
Гипервизор — в компьютерах программа или аппаратная схема, обеспечивающая или позволяющая одновременное, параллельное выполнение нескольких или даже многих операционных систем на одном и том же хост-компьютере. Гипервизор также обеспечивает изоляцию операционных систем друг от друга, защиту и безопасность, разделение ресурсов между различными запущенными ОС и управление ресурсами. Гипервизор также может (но не обязан) предоставлять работающим под его управлением на одном хост-компьютере ОС средства связи и взаимодействия между собой (например, через обмен файлами или сетевые соединения) так, как если бы эти ОС выполнялись на разных физических компьютерах. Гипервизор сам по себе в некотором роде является минимальной операционной системой (микроядром или наноядром). Он предоставляет запущенным под его управлением операционным системам сервис виртуальной машины, виртуализируя или эмулируя реальное (физическое) аппаратное обеспечение конкретной машины, и управляет этими виртуальными машинами, выделением и освобождением ресурсов для них. Гипервизор позволяет независимое «включение», перезагрузку, «выключение» любой из виртуальных машин с той или иной ОС. При этом операционная система, работающая в виртуальной машине под управлением гипервизора, вовсе не обязана знать, что она выполняется в виртуальной машине, а не на реальном аппаратном обеспечении, хотя и может. «>

Сижу и бьюсь головой как же я раньше то не встречал таких терминов в тех литературе ? может это слово ГИПЕРВИЗОР — поменялось на слово Virtual Machine = виртуальная ОСЬ или еще что то …. теперь буду обзывать virtualbox — «HyperVisorBOX»
— так даже веселее .

hyper-visorНедавно сам начал пользоваться сием чудом Virtual Box ака HyperVisorBOX 🙂 очень доволен , так как все что мне нужно я в нем могу реализовать . Подумываю развернуть несколько сервачков для нужд на нем же . 🙂

Тем более недавно вышел релиз виртуал бокса , с нововведениями знакомимся ниже а качать на офф сайте : http://www.virtualbox.org/

Компания Sun Microsystems выпустила релиз системы виртуализации VirtualBox 3.1.0.

Основные новшества:

* Технология live-миграции, позволяет переносить работающее виртуальное окружение с одной машины на другую, незаметно для работающих внутри приложений;
* Состояние виртуальной машины теперь может быть восстановлено из любого ранее сохраненного снапшота, а не только последнего как было раньше. При этом новые снапшоты могут создаваться как производные от старых, образуя ответвления;
* Поддержка 2D акселерации вывода видео для гостевых окружений с Windows, задействовав при этом аппаратные возможности GPU хост-системы;
* Тип подключения к сети может быть изменен на лету для работающей виртуальной машины;
* Экспериментальная поддержка USB для хост-окружений под OpenSolaris теперь использует возможности улучшенного USB стека, появившегося начиная со сборки Solaris Nevada 124;
* Значительное увеличение производительности для PAE и AMD64 гостевых окружений, работающих при задействовании аппаратной виртуализации (VT-x и AMD-V);
* Экспериментальная поддержка интерфейса EFI (Extended Firmware Interface), используемого вместо BIOS, например, на компьютерах Apple;
* Поддержка драйверов сетевых устройств, работающих в режиме паравиртуализации (virtio-net), что позволяет минимизировать накладные расходы при выполнении сетевых операций в гостевых окружениях;
* Более гибкие средства подключения внешних накопителей: CD/DVD могут подключаться к любому IDE контроллеру, возможно подключение более одного устройства;
* В интерфейсе пользователя для сохраненных снапшотов теперь отображается скриншот экрана с состоянием в момент заморозки;
* В код эмуляции графической 3D подсистемы добавлена реализация OpenGL расширений GL_EXT_framebuffer_object и GL_EXT_compiled_vertex_array;
* Во встроенную реализацию транслятора адресов (NAT) добавлен режим проксирование DNS запросов через резолвер хост-системы;
* Добавлена возможность работы с образами виртуальных машин в формате HDD (Parallels 2);
* Исправлено около 40 ошибок.